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Campbells Meerkatze | Javan Chorus Frog |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Tier) | Animalia (Tier)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ordatiere) | Chordata (Chordatiere) |
| Class | Mammalia (Säugetiere) | Amphibia (Amphibien) |
| Order | Primates (Primaten) | Anura (Froschlurche) |
| Family | Cercopithecidae (Old World Monkeys) | Microhylidae |
| Genus | Cercopithecus | Microhyla |
| Species | Cercopithecus campbelli | Microhyla achatina |
Evolutionary Relationship
Campbells Meerkatze and Javan Chorus Frog share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ordatiere)
